The Art of Silent Communication: Sending Messages Without Words

Communication extends far beyond the confines of spoken language. Often, the most powerful messages are the ones delivered without a single word, relying on presence, expression, and action to convey truth. This silent dialogue forms the backbone of human connection, allowing understanding to flourish in the spaces between sounds.

The Language of Presence

Simply showing up can communicate volumes about care, commitment, and respect. In a world saturated with digital noise, the decision to be fully present is a profound statement. Maintaining steady eye contact, offering a genuine smile, or adopting an open posture demonstrates active listening and genuine interest without the need for verbal confirmation.

Nonverbal Emotional Resonance

Emotions are contagious, and our bodies act as transmitters long before our minds formulate a sentence. A reassuring touch on the shoulder can provide more comfort than a lengthy pep talk, while a shared look of solidarity can express support during difficult times. This intuitive understanding bypasses intellectual barriers and connects directly with the heart, proving that empathy often requires no translation.

Artistry and Intentional Action

Creativity serves as a universal dialect, allowing individuals to express complex feelings and ideas through mediums other than speech. A painter transforms canvas into emotion, a chef crafts a meal as an act of love, and a gardener shapes nature into a statement of patience. These creations speak to the human experience, conveying passion, struggle, and joy in a language understood by all.

Composing a handwritten letter to articulate gratitude.

Volunteering time to demonstrate compassion for a community.

Designing a personal space that reflects inner identity and values.

Silence as a Communicative Force

Far from being empty, silence holds significant weight in conversation. It can denote deep thought, convey respect for another’s perspective, or establish a boundary. In a culture that often fears quiet moments, embracing silence communicates confidence, patience, and the willingness to listen rather than dominate the narrative.

Relational Dynamics and Boundaries

Interactions between people are complex, and sometimes the loudest message is delivered by distance. Creating space, limiting contact, or adhering to consistent routines can signal a need for independence, a shift in priorities, or the establishment of firm personal boundaries. This relational language protects energy and clarifies intentions without the confrontation of explicit statements.

The Digital Dimension of Silent Expression

Modern technology has expanded the vocabulary of silence through digital interaction. The deliberate choice not to respond to a message, the timing of a reply, or the selection of a profile picture all contribute to a narrative. Understanding these digital cues allows individuals to navigate online relationships with the same nuance applied to face-to-face encounters, interpreting the messages hidden in the gaps.
